In singularity theory and algebraic geometry, the monodromy group is
embodied in the Picard-Lefschetz formula and the Picard-Fuchs equations.
It has applications in the weakened 16th Hilbert problem and
in mixed Hodge structures. There is a deep connection of monodromy
theory with Galois theory of differential equations and algebraic
functions. In covering these and other topics, this book underlines the
unifying role of the monogropy group.
